Teaching style

My teaching style emphasizes movement, collaboration, and engagement. I regularly use task cards and station-based learning to keep students actively involved and learning at their own pace. Peer collaboration is a key part of my classroom, as working together helps students build confidence, strengthen understanding, and develop a sense of community.
